无障碍设计:构建包容性网站框架指南
|
无障碍设计的核心在于让每一位用户,无论身体能力如何,都能平等地访问和使用网站。这不仅关乎技术实现,更是一种以人为本的设计理念。当网站对视力障碍者、听力障碍者、行动不便者或认知障碍者友好时,整个网络环境才真正具备包容性。 为确保内容可读性,应使用清晰的字体大小与对比度。文字与背景之间需保持足够的视觉反差,避免使用仅靠颜色区分信息的方式。例如,不能仅用红色标注错误提示,而应结合图标或文字说明,确保色盲用户也能理解。 图像内容必须配有替代文本(alt text),简明描述图像所传达的信息。若图片为装饰性元素,也应设置空的替代文本,避免干扰屏幕阅读器用户的体验。视频内容则需提供字幕与音频描述,帮助听障及视障用户完整获取信息。 键盘导航是无障碍设计的重要一环。许多用户无法使用鼠标,依赖键盘进行操作。因此,所有功能按钮、链接和表单元素都应能通过Tab键顺序访问,并有明确的焦点指示。页面结构应逻辑清晰,使用语义化标签如、、、等,帮助辅助技术理解页面层次。 表单设计也需注重易用性。每个输入框应配有清晰的标签,并在出错时提供具体、可操作的提示信息。避免使用模糊的“请检查输入”类提示,而是指出具体问题,如“请输入有效的邮箱地址”。 动态内容更新时,应通过Aria-live属性通知屏幕阅读器用户。例如,提交表单后弹出的成功提示,若未及时告知,可能被视障用户忽略。同时,避免自动播放音频或视频,若必须启用,应提供明显的暂停或关闭控制。
创意图AI设计,仅供参考 测试是保障无障碍的关键步骤。除了使用自动化工具检测,还应邀请真实用户参与测试,尤其是来自不同能力背景的人群。他们的反馈能揭示设计中隐藏的问题,推动持续优化。 构建包容性网站并非一次性任务,而是一个持续迭代的过程。每一次更新、每一段代码,都应以“是否对所有人友好”为出发点。当设计从“适配少数人”转向“服务所有人”,我们才能真正实现数字世界的公平与连接。 (编辑:PHP编程网 - 钦州站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330484号